Weekend Box Office Update (Apr 27-29, 2018)--Avengers Rule

Good evening Disney friends, 

Let's get straight into the records. First, Disney broke its own record for the fastest company to get to $1 billion for the domestic market (117 days,) which beats the previous record of 126 days. Disney has now broken the $1 billion mark faster than other film companies for the past 3 years. Also, with Avengers breaking the domestic opening weekend record, Disney films hold 9 of the 10 top grossing weekend films. 
Now for Avengers: Infinity War and the estimated $250 million premiere weekend for the domestic market. That beats Star Wars: The Force Awakens for the largest opening weekend by approximately $2 million. What makes that even more impressive is that Avengers spotted Force almost $18 million on Thursday night previews. To make up for that, Avengers had to do great over the weekend and did so with the largest domestic Saturday of all time, by beating Jurassic World by over $13 million (Avengers Saturday was estimated at $83 million.) It is already the second highest grossing film of the year. The film has set the following records: highest opening weekend, highest Saturday, and highest Sunday. It was also the fastest film to $150, $200, and $250 mil. Now this is assuming that he estimates hold true, but some things to think about--Disney has underestimated their Sunday grosses for the last Black Panther and the 2 previous Avengers films.

In terms of the international box office--the filmed grossed $380 million, which is best for 2nd all time opening weekend. The first place film was Fate of the FuriousAvengers was probably not going to break the international box office record because it was not opening in China and Russia. When Fate opened to a total of $443 mil, it had the advantage of China where it opened to $185 mil. However, when the domestic and international receipts are added together, the Avengers grossed $630 mil which beat Fate by almost $90 mil ($541 mil.) 

All told, it was a great weekend for the House of Mouse. 

By the way, Black Panther did really good compared to all other films in the top 10. Black Panther is estimated to gross around $4.4 mil, which is good enough for number 5 for the weekend and saw only a drop of 11.2% compared to previous weekend, but most other films dropped around 50% or more. 

The next question for the Avengers: Infinity War is how far will it climb. It has 3 weeks until Deadpool 2 opens and 4 weeks until Solo: A Star Wars Story opens.
